South Sudan currently reports a newly interally displaced persons associated with conflict and violence of 282,000, a decrease of 55,000 (-16.3%) from 2022.

South Sudan Newly displaced by conflict and violence between 2011 and 2023
| Period |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2023 | 282,000 | -55,000 |
| 2022 | 337,000 | -92,000 |
| 2021 | 429,000 | +158,000 |
| 2020 | 271,000 | +12,000 |
| 2019 | 259,000 | -62,000 |
| 2018 | 321,000 | -536,000 |
| 2017 | 857,000 | +576,000 |
| 2016 | 281,000 | +82,000 |
| 2015 | 199,000 | -1,105,000 |
| 2014 | 1,304,000 | +921,000 |
| 2013 | 383,000 | +193,000 |
| 2012 | 190,000 | -160,000 |
| 2011 | 350,000 |
